Output 31fbd576df4c2bac3a448540026261623eec64e72f4d8510583676422266a77e:1

value
1416262
script pubkey
OP_0 OP_PUSHBYTES_20 23c62dc7edfdf8cbe746862792d637f8fe8bfb34
address
bc1qy0rzm3ldlhuvhe6xscne943hlrlgh7e5u6jeua
transaction
31fbd576df4c2bac3a448540026261623eec64e72f4d8510583676422266a77e
spent
true